Game Preview

Green Bay did well against the Commanders, beating the rivals on Thursday Night Football, 27-18. Even though they weren’t perfect and there were plenty of issues in their performance, the Packers had no problems against Washington.

Josh Jacobs had 84 rushing yards for a TD, while TE Tucker Kraft caught 6 passes for 124 yards and one TD too. Love ended the game with 292 passing yards and two TD passes. Micah Parsons posted 0.5 sacks and 3 QB hits.

The Browns’ defense fell apart in Baltimore, allowing 41 points. Myles Garrett had 1.5 sacks and 2 quarterback hits, but overall, Cleveland was outplayed in every possible aspect of the game. Not just in defense, but offense too.

Joe Flacco threw for 199 yards, but missed 20 passes, and had a pick with one touchdown. He also fumbled and lost one ball. Dillon Gabriel, a second-string QB, came off the bench to post a TD pass, and all three of his pass attempts were precise.

Packers vs. Browns Head to Head

The overall result in the series is 14-7 for the Packers, with the note that the Packers won the previous 4 events.
